    About the Role

    Contributes to Finance and Accounting Operations in overseeing and managing bank reconciliation team and processes efficiently and in ensuring end-to-end controls and processes are in accordance with SOP.

    Roles & Responsibilities :

  • Oversee, review and manage AIAMY bank reconciliation accounts to ensure reasonable and justifiable balances and ageing. Ensure regular and consistent improvement to unreconciled items with system enhancement/LEAN processes/automation, with aim to achieve optimal auto-matching.
  • Review and report bank reconciliation monthly and quarterly position to management with irregularities (if any) all flagged and escalated with ample explanations, actions taken/planned and proposed solutions where necessary. Ensure planned actions and solutions are followed-through.
  • Manage the team to ensure bank recon queries or requests from internal /external auditors / regulators / services recipients are attended to within service level agreed.
  • Identify training needs for self and team to ensure relevant skills are upgraded with continual personal development plans. Cultivate a high-performing team with habits to value-add.
  • Collaborate with business/vendors for opportunities/solutions to comprehensive, fool-proof and sustainable transaction records and for optimal reconciliation process.
  • Regularly review processes and controls with look-out for risks and/or control gaps and then follow-through with solutions or proposals in mitigation. Ensure SOPs are updated and adhered to.
  • Set, agree and continuously review targets by AIAMY entities bank reconciliation position and work on and monitor plans and milestones with the team to achieve them. Always with mindset to empower the team and also work together to remove obstacles to success.
